Other Power Savers:
The LiteSava does not use a capacitor that attempts to alter the Power Factor of any circuit. Devices that use these types of systems do not work. These so called 'Power Savers' sometimes affect the amp reading. Changing the appliance Amps does not reduce the cost of electricity.Your electricity usage is measured and charged in Watts and Kilowatt Hours not Amps.

Background:
The mains voltage supply from your supplier varies enormously subject to changes in power usage by other consumers, grid power losses, weather and atmospheric conditions. Variations in mains supply above your lighting rated voltage causes costly problems. The majority of lighting systems operate at maximum efficiency at 230 Volts in Europe and 110/120V in USA, Canada and Japan. An increase in voltage supply of as little as 4.3% to 240 Volts in Europe creates; higher power usage (up to 13% more power), shortens lighting systems life cycle and increases CO2 emissions. Stopping over-voltage supply is critical in reducing: cost to the consumer; power generation and CO2 emissions.

Operation:
Each LiteSava unit can regulate up to 2,500 Watts (2.5 KW) - when connected to the RCB(s) that serve the light and 3.0 KW when connected to a fan circuit. When the Mains Switch is turned on, the LiteSava starts working. The integrated Power Meter allows the measurement of Watt usage both before and after the LiteSava is triggered. The unit can also record the incoming Voltage; total KW used; and the duration of usage.
System Compatibility:
The LiteSava will work with mains Fluorescent lights (traditional and electronic ballast), tungsten, halogen, filament lights and fan systems without reducing performance.

Specifications:
Voltage: 200V - 250V~, 50Hz.
Maximum Amps: 13 Amps.
Maximum Load: 2.5KW - Fluorescent lightings only - 3.0KW for all others
Power Consumption: ≤1 Watt on standby - 100 Watts at maximum load.
Site: Covered dry environment.
Use: Fluorescent (traditional & electronic ballast), tungsten, halogen,
filament lights & fan units.
Operational Range: -10 to 60º C, 10 to 95% humidity.
Mains Switch: 13 Amps
Wiring: Direct to RCB in consumer or distribution board, up to 4.0 mm
twin and earth.
Fixing: 3 point with 3.5 x 30 mm screws supplied.
Footprint (Approximately): 188mm(L)x108mm(W)x77.5mm(H)
Weight (Approximately): 600 grams
The LiteSava does not work with: Metal Halide (MH) or High Intensity Discharge (HID); CDMT or CHA Systems; High Frequency Ballasts.
